REUTERS\/Andrew Kelly<\/figcaption><\/figure>\n<p>LOS ANGELES (Reuters) \u2013 Pop superstar Taylor\u200b Swift rocked concert \u200cstages, \u2062cinemas, local economies \u2013 and even the Earth \u2013 in 2023.<\/p>\n<div id=\"div-gpt-ad-1663871513696-art-3\" style=\"min-width: 320px; min-height: 50px; text-align: center;\">  \t<script>  \t\tgoogletag.cmd.push(function() { googletag.display('div-gpt-ad-1663871513696-art-3'); });  \t<\/script>  <\/div>\n<div class=\"ad-slot__ad-label\">Advertisement<\/div>\n<\/p>\n<p>Swift\u2019s Eras Tour sold out stadiums and pumped millions of \u200ddollars \u2062into\u2062 each city it visited. A movie\u200b version of the show lit up theaters, racking up \u200d$250 million in ticket sales.<\/p>\n<p>With 26 billion streams, Swift ranked as Spotify\u2019s most popular artist of the year. In \u2062July, the 33-year-old became the first female artist to have four albums on Billboard\u2019s \u2063top 10 list at the same time.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cShe keeps leveling up,\u201d said Colin\u200c Stutz, news director at \u200cBillboard. He ranked Swift\u2019s achievements alongside\u2062 musical elites such as The\u2063 Beatles, Elvis\u200d Presley and Michael\u200d Jackson.<\/p>\n<p>If Swift were a record label, Stutz said, the \u201cAnti-Hero\u201d singer would stand as\u200d the fourth\u2062 largest in the U.S. by revenue from\u2064 her touring, merchandise, streams\u2063 and other sources.<\/p>\n<p>Time magazine named Swift its 2023 \u201cPerson of the\u200d Year\u201d.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cThis is the proudest and happiest I\u2019ve ever felt, and the most\u200c creatively fulfilled and free\u2064 I\u2019ve \u200dever been,\u201d Swift\u2063 told the\u200b magazine.<\/p>\n<p>In 2023, the singer\u200c released re-recordings of two records \u2013 \u201cSpeak Now\u201d and \u201c1989\u201d \u2013 as part of her effort to take control of her back \u200bcatalog.<\/p>\n<p>A Swift concert in Seattle caused \u200da \u2063small earthquake. Thousands of dancing fans set off a nearby seismometer, registering the equivalent of a magnitude 2.3 quake.<\/p>\n<p>For 2024, the Swift Effect will \u2063spread around the \u200cworld as her tour hits Asia, Australia, Europe and Canada.<\/p>\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\">WHY \u2063IT MATTERS<\/h2>\n<p>Swift did not just rule the music business. She lifted \u200clocal\u2064 economies, encouraged voter registrations and brought more\u200b viewers\u200b to professional football.<\/p>\n<p>The Eras Tour grossed\u2062 more\u2063 than $900 million in ticket sales, Billboard estimates. The media\u2063 outlet projects that will nearly double by the end\u200d of 2024 and surpass Elton John\u2019s Farewell \u200cYellow Brick\u2064 Road Tour as \u2064the highest-grossing tour in history.<\/p>\n<p>Each stop\u2063 by Swift brought an influx of \u2063Swifties who \u2063spent money on hotels, meals and more. Celebrities and moms and dads also\u200b joined their\u200b superfan children for one of the hottest tickets of \u200cthe year.<\/p>\n<p>While\u200c it is\u2062 hard to reliably estimate \u200dSwift\u2019s economic impact, \u200dit was notable enough for \u200cthe Federal Reserve Bank\u200b of Philadelphia to \u2062cite a three-night Eras run as \u2062a driver of tourist traffic.<\/p>\n<p>One contact\u2063 told Fed researchers that May \u200cwas \u201cthe \u200cstrongest month \u200dfor hotel revenue in \u200bPhiladelphia since the onset of \u2064the \u200dpandemic, in large part due to \u2062an influx of guests for the\u200b Taylor Swift concerts,\u201d a July report said.<\/p>\n<p>Two shows \u200bin Denver injected $140 \u2063million into Colorado, local \u200cauthorities estimate. Six nights near Los Angeles\u200d added $320 million and 3,300 jobs to the area,\u2063 according to the California Center\u2062 for Jobs and the Economy.<\/p>\n<p>Swift\u2019s impact \u2064had local politicians \u2063embracing her.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cMayor\u200b after mayor would rename their\u2062 city for a day,\u201d said \u200bArizona \u200cState \u2063University Professor Margaretha Bentley. Glendale, Arizona, for example, temporarily became Swift City.<\/p>\n<p>Bentley is teaching a class next\u2062 year called Taylor Swift (Public Policy Version). It \u2063will explore government\u2064 through the lens of Swift, looking at topics such as\u2064 her impact on voter registration. After Swift urged fans to register, Vote.org reported 35,000 signups.\u200c Harvard, Stanford and other colleges also offer courses \u200bon Swift\u2019s songwriting and influence.<\/p>\n<p>In sports,\u2062 Swift\u2019s high-profile romance with \u200dKansas City Chiefs star Travis Kelce brought new viewers to football games. Sales of Kelce jerseys jumped 400% in one day, online seller Fanatics\u200b said.<\/p>\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\">WHAT IT MEANS FOR\u2064 2O24<\/h2>\n<p>While Swift was seemingly everywhere in 2023, her Eras\u2062 Tour only spanned the U.S., Mexico, Brazil and Argentina. \u200bIn February, it heads\u2062 to\u200d Tokyo before swinging through Australia, Singapore and Europe. It wraps in Vancouver in December 2024.<\/p>\n<p>Swift may \u2063be seen at February\u2019s Grammys, where her record \u201cMidnights\u201d will contend for album of\u200b the year.<\/p>\n<p>The superstar also may release another re-recording, or two in the coming\u200d year, Stutz said.
